A Model Context Protocol (MCP) Server providing LLM tools for the official ClinicalTrials.gov REST API. Search and retrieve clinical trial data, including study details and more

Overview

Seven tools for searching, discovering, analyzing, and matching clinical trials:

Tool NameDescription
`clinicaltrials_search_studies`Search studies with full-text queries, filters, pagination, sorting, and field selection.
`clinicaltrials_get_study_record`Fetch a single study by NCT ID. Returns the full record: protocol, eligibility, outcomes, arms, interventions, contacts, and locations.
`clinicaltrials_get_study_count`Get total study count for a query without fetching data. Fast statistics and breakdowns.
`clinicaltrials_get_field_values`Discover valid values for API fields (status, phase, study type, etc.) with per-value counts.
`clinicaltrials_get_field_definitions`Browse the study data model field tree — piece names, types, nesting. Supports subtree navigation and keyword search.
`clinicaltrials_get_study_results`Extract outcomes, adverse events, participant flow, and baseline from completed studies. Optional summary mode reduces ~200KB payloads to ~5KB; `outcomeLimit` / `adverseEventLimit` cap full mode without leaving it.
`clinicaltrials_find_eligible`Match patient demographics and conditions to eligible recruiting trials. Provide age, sex, conditions, and location to find studies with matching eligibility criteria, contacts, and recruiting locations.
ResourceDescription
`clinicaltrials://{nctId}`Fetch a single clinical trial study by NCT ID. Protocol JSON with capped locations/outcomes/references and results replaced by counts; omissions reported with the tool that retrieves them.
PromptDescription
`analyze_trial_landscape`Adaptable workflow for data-driven trial landscape analysis using count + search tools.

Tools

`clinicaltrials_search_studies`

Primary search tool with full ClinicalTrials.gov query capabilities.

  • Full-text and field-specific queries (condition, intervention, sponsor, location, title, outcome)
  • Status and phase filters with typed enum values
  • Geographic proximity filtering by coordinates and distance
  • Advanced AREA[] Essie expression support for complex queries
  • Compact index results by default; pass `fields` for a full-fidelity projection of specific leaves (a full single record is ~70KB — fetch one with `get_study_record`)
  • Pagination with cursor tokens, sorting by any field

`clinicaltrials_get_study_results`

Fetch posted results data for completed studies.

  • Outcome measures with statistics, adverse events, participant flow, baseline characteristics
  • Section-level filtering (request only the data you need)
  • Optional summary mode condenses full results (~200KB) to essential metadata (~5KB per study)
  • Batch multiple NCT IDs per call with partial-success reporting
  • Separate tracking of studies without results and fetch errors

`clinicaltrials_find_eligible`

Match a patient profile to eligible recruiting trials.

  • Takes age, sex, conditions, and location as patient demographics
  • Builds optimized API queries with demographic filters (age range, sex, healthy volunteers)
  • Re-ranks results so studies whose own condition matches a requested condition surface above tangential matches from the upstream fuzzy condition search
  • Returns studies with eligibility and location fields for the caller to evaluate
  • Bounds each candidate to the sites matching the requested location (capped by `locationLimit`) rather than every site the study registers worldwide, adds the nearest recruiting site when none of the matched ones is open, and discloses what was omitted
  • Provides actionable hints when no studies match (broaden conditions, adjust filters)

Features

Built on `@cyanheads/mcp-ts-core`:

  • Declarative tool/resource/prompt definitions with Zod schemas and format functions
  • Unified error handling — handlers throw, framework catches and classifies
  • Dual transport: stdio and Streamable HTTP from the same codebase
  • Pluggable auth (`none`, `jwt`, `oauth`) for HTTP transport
  • Structured logging with optional OpenTelemetry tracing

ClinicalTrials.gov-specific:

  • Type-safe client for the ClinicalTrials.gov REST API v2
  • Public API — no authentication or API keys required
  • Retry with exponential backoff (3 attempts) and rate limiting (~1 req/sec)
  • HTML error detection and structured error factories

Configuration

All configuration is optional — the server works with defaults and no API keys.

VariableDescriptionDefault
`CT_API_BASE_URL`ClinicalTrials.gov API base URL.`https://clinicaltrials.gov/api/v2`
`CT_REQUEST_TIMEOUT_MS`Per-request timeout in milliseconds.`30000`
`CT_MAX_PAGE_SIZE`Maximum page size cap.`200`
`MCP_TRANSPORT_TYPE`Transport: `stdio` or `http`.`stdio`
`MCP_HTTP_PORT`Port for HTTP server.`3010`
`MCP_AUTH_MODE`Auth mode: `none`, `jwt`, or `oauth`.`none`
`MCP_LOG_LEVEL`Log level (RFC 5424).`info`
`LOGS_DIR`Directory for log files (Node.js only).`/logs`
`OTEL_ENABLED`Enable OpenTelemetry tracing.`false`
